Bullish option flow detected in Xerox with 2,459 calls trading, 3x expected, and implied vol increasing almost 2 points to 69.94%. Oct-24 12 calls and Jul-24 11 puts are the most active options, with total volume in those strikes near 1,600 contracts. The Put/Call Ratio is 0.34. Earnings are expected on July 23rd.
Invest with Confidence:
- Follow TipRanks' Top Wall Street Analysts to uncover their success rate and average return.
- Join thousands of data-driven investors – Build your Smart Portfolio for personalized insights.